Over 30,000 acres scorched in wildfires across 17 Oklahoma counties 

Evacuations ordered in areas like Shattuck and Gage due to approaching flames.

Firefighters battling challenging conditions with limited air support, seeking relief.

Cold front expected to bring temporary reprieve with lower temperatures 

Increased fire risk in Oklahoma during winter-to-spring due to dry vegetation 

Oklahomans urged to exercise extreme caution and follow safety guidelines.

Evacuation shelters established at various locations to support displaced individuals.
